Understanding Adjustment of Status and Its Complexities
Adjustment of Status is the method by which a person shifts their immigration standing from a temporary or undocumented status to that of a lawful permanent resident. It may sound like a single step, but it actually requires numerous applications, supporting paperwork, medical assessments, background checks, and in many cases an in-person meeting. Each of these steps has its own collection of rules, and neglecting even a minor item can bring about processing slowdowns or flat-out refusals.

How an Attorney Helps You Avoid Costly Mistakes
One of the biggest reasons to retain an attorney is the staggering amount of paperwork that comes with the process. Form I-485, the primary petition for Adjustment of Status, is just the beginning. Depending on your circumstances, you may also be required to file Form I-130, Form I-864, employment authorization documents, and travel authorization documents — each with precise directions and evidence criteria. An experienced attorney understands just which paperwork are applicable to your specific circumstances and the proper way to prepare them without errors the very first time.
Inaccuracies on immigration forms are not minor hassles. A wrong reply, a overlooked signature, or an incomplete section can trigger a Request for Evidence from USCIS, which contributes significant delays to your schedule. In weightier cases, conflicting details or errors may arouse suspicion that result in further examination or even assumptions of fraud. An legal representative goes over every item before submittal, dramatically lowering the possibility of these complications.
Beyond paperwork, attorneys grasp the legal nuances that most applicants simply aren’t aware of. For example, specific past immigration infractions, criminal records, or prior deportation orders can generate bars to eligibility that aren’t necessarily evident. A skilled lawyer can evaluate your record candidly and help you understand whether a waiver is accessible or if an alternative course of action would better serve your goals.

Who is eligible to apply for Adjustment of Status in Progreso, TX?
Eligibility for Adjustment of Status ordinarily calls for that the petitioner has an accepted immigrant application, has an readily available immigrant visa number, was legally admitted or paroled into the United States, and is not subject to any barriers to adjustment. What documents are required for an Adjustment of Status application?
Petitioners generally must be prepared to submit Form I-485, a copy of their certificate of birth, passport-style pictures, evidence of legitimate admission into the United States, an accepted immigration petition, health exam results from a approved civil surgeon, monetary support documentation such as Form I-864 Affidavit of Support, and any additional materials relevant to their situation. Can I work in the United States while my Adjustment of Status application is pending?
Petitioners who have applied for Adjustment of Status may petition for an Employment Authorization Document (EAD) using Form I-765, which affords them the legal right to seek employment in the United States while their case is awaiting adjudication. What happens if my Adjustment of Status application is denied?
Should an Adjustment of Status application is denied, the individual will be sent a notice detailing the reasons for the denial. Depending on the situation, there might be remedies accessible such as filing a formal motion to reopen or reconsider, appealing the decision, or pursuing additional immigration remedies.
